I can confirm that E620 now works correctly, i.e I can go online and
browse etc, using Vodafone Mobile Connect in Kubuntu Karmic on AMD64
with the 2.6.31-15-generic kernel.

Plugged in and out, and went on and off line several times, it worked at
every attempt. And, it reverted correctly to ethernet or wifi
afterwards.

But I am using wicd, not network-manager!

There may be a slight anomaly, as it seems to occupy ttyUSB0, 1 and 2.
Should it do that?
